Micron

Micron Technology, Inc., commonly referred to as Micron, is a leading American semiconductor manufacturer headquartered in Boise, Idaho. Founded in 1978, the company has established itself as a key player in the global memory and storage solutions industry, with significant operations across North America, Europe, and Asia. Micron specialises in DRAM, NAND flash memory, and storage solutions, catering to a diverse range of sectors including computing, mobile, automotive, and data centre markets. Renowned for its innovative technologies, Micron's products are distinguished by their performance, reliability, and efficiency, making them essential for modern computing needs. With a strong market position, Micron has achieved numerous milestones, including advancements in 3D NAND technology and a commitment to sustainability in semiconductor manufacturing. The company continues to drive growth and innovation, solidifying its reputation as a trusted leader in the memory and storage industry.

Micron's reported carbon emissions

In 2022, Micron Technology, headquartered in the US, reported significant carbon emissions, totalling approximately 7,610,655,000 kg CO2e across all scopes. This includes about 3,478,449,000 kg CO2e from Scope 1 emissions, which encompass direct emissions from owned or controlled sources, and approximately 4,132,206,000 kg CO2e from Scope 2 emissions, related to indirect emissions from the generation of purchased electricity. Additionally, Scope 3 emissions, which cover all other indirect emissions, amounted to about 3,000,000,000 kg CO2e. Micron has set ambitious climate commitments, aiming for a 42% absolute reduction in Scope 1 emissions by 2030, using 2020 as the baseline. Furthermore, the company is committed to achieving net zero emissions for both Scope 1 and Scope 2 by 2050, aligning with the objectives of the Paris Agreement. These initiatives reflect Micron's dedication to sustainability and reducing its carbon footprint in the semiconductor industry.
